The incident: Corona virus: Information from the state of North Rhine-Westphalia

The North Rhine-Westphalian state government has adapted the Corona Protection Ordinance to the Infection Protection Act amended by the federal legislature. The amended ordinance came into force on March 20, 2022 and is valid up to and including April 2, 2022. All rules, the exact wording of the Corona Protection Ordinance and answers to frequently asked questions can be found at: www.land.nrw/corona The most important adjustments for North Rhine-Westphalia at a glance: Restrictions on contact in private no longer apply Restrictions on personal contact no longer apply, regardless of vaccination or recovery status. Capacity/person limits no longer apply All facilities and events for which the occupancy rate was previously limited in percentage terms or by absolute maximum limits can now be fully occupied again. The mask requirements indoors (e.g. in public transport, shops) and at indoor events with more than 1,000 people remain in place. Elimination of access restrictions and the obligation to wear masks outdoors With immediate effect, the access restrictions (3G, 2G, 2G+) are no longer applicable to offers for youth work, outdoor sports, meetings, weddings and celebrations in private rooms. 3G and no longer 2G+ applies to major events. 3G also applies to public festivals. Masks are not compulsory outdoors. The recommendation to wear mouth and nose protection in situations with many people in a confined space still applies.
